Matthew 21
verse 21-22 says: "Jesus replied, "I tell you the truth, if you have faith and do not doubt, not only can you do what was done to the fig tree, but also you can say to this mountain, 'Go, throw yourself into the sea,' and it will be done. If you believe, you will receive whatever you ask for in prayer." Check out Mathew 17:20. Think of all the things that we can do if we only have faith in our Lord Jesus.
Matthew 24
verse 36 says "No one knows about that day or hour, not even the angels in heaven, nor the Son,[6] but only the Father." But if the Son is the Father, then how come the Son doesn't know?

Matthew 25
verse 15- Do you know what Judas betryed Jesus for? 30 silver coins. I wonder how much that is worth in our terms today. What would you betray Jesus for? what HAVE you betrayed Jesus for? Money? material wealth? work? lust? time? the list goes on...
verse 25... Jesus already knew that Judas was going to betray him and it sounds like Jesus basically called him out at the last supper. Did the other disciples not hear this? Why didn't they do anything about it?
